body {
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
}
td,th {
	font-size: 12px;
	color: #4F4F4F;
}
p {
	text-indent: 2em;
	margin: 0px 0px 8px;
	padding: 0px;
}

.top {
	text-align: center;
	margin: 0px auto;
	padding: 0px;
	width: 100%;
}
.leftside {
	background: url(../images/bg_left.jpg) no-repeat;
	width: 140px;
}
.bg_newspro {
	background: url(../images/bg_newspro.jpg) repeat-x top;
}
.bg_news {
	background: url(../images/bg_news.jpg) no-repeat right center;
	height: 434px;
}

.bg2 {
	background-image: url(../images/bg2.jpg);
	background-repeat: no-repeat;
	background-position: center center;
}
.bg_mend {
	background: url(../images/bg_mend.jpg) no-repeat right top;
	height: 500px;
}

.topnav_bg {
	background-image: url(../images/topnav_bg.jpg);
	background-repeat: repeat-x;
	background-position: center top;
}
.ad_bg {
	background-image: url(../images/ad_bg.jpg);
	background-repeat: no-repeat;
	background-position: center center;
}
.bg_line {
	border-bottom: 1px solid #CCCCCC;
}
.brokenline {
	background-image: url(../images/brokenline.jpg);
	background-repeat: repeat-x;
	background-position: center bottom;
}

.ash {
	border-bottom: 2px solid #E0E0E0;
}
.ash a {
	color: #4F4F4F;
	text-decoration: none;
}
.ash a:hover {
	text-decoration: none;
	color: #B50000;
}
.ash em {
	font-weight: bold;
	color: #FF0000;
	font-style: normal;
}

.ash_pro{
}
.ash_pro a {
	color: #4F4F4F;
	text-decoration: none;
}
.ash_pro a:hover {
	text-decoration: none;
	color: #B50000;
}
.ash_pro em {
	font-weight: bold;
	color: #FF0000;
	font-style: normal;
}

a.apage {
	color: #4f4f4f;
	text-decoration: none;
}
a.apage:hover {
	text-decoration: none;
	color: #CC0000;
}
a.anews {
	color: #4f4f4f;
	text-decoration: none;
}
a.anews:hover {
	text-decoration: none;
	color: #CC0000;
}
a.ared {
	color: #CC0000;
	text-decoration: none;
}
a.ared:hover {
	text-decoration: none;
	color: #FF8000;
}
a.aproduct {
	padding: 17px;
	display: block;
	width: 145px;
}
a.aproduct:hover {
	text-decoration: none;
	background: url(../images/bg2.jpg) no-repeat;
}
a.asort {
	background: url(../images/bg_menuoff.jpg) no-repeat;
	height: 23px;
	width: 165px;
	display: block;
	font-size: 14px;
	line-height: 23px;
	font-weight: bold;
	text-decoration: none;
	color: #000000;
}
a.asort_on {
	background: url(../images/bg_menuon.jpg) no-repeat;
	margin: 0px;
	padding: 0px;
	height: 23px;
	width: 163px;
	display: block;
	font-size: 14px;
	font-weight: bold;
	color: #FFFFFF;
	text-decoration: none;
	line-height: 23px;
}




.content {
	margin: 12px;
	padding: 0px;
	line-height: 200%;
	color: #666666;
}
.content2 {
	line-height: 180%;
	color: #000000;
	letter-spacing: 1px;
}


.title {
	font-size: 14px;
	line-height: 160%;
	color: #CC0000;
	font-weight: bold;
	margin: 5px;
	padding: 0px;
}
.title_newspro {
	font-size: 18px;
	color: #FF0000;
	font-weight: bold;
}




.font {
	font-family: "宋体";
	font-size: 12px;
	line-height: 25px;
	color: #666666;
	text-decoration: none;
}
.dot {
	background-image: url(../images/dot.jpg);
	background-repeat: repeat-x;
	background-position: center bottom;
}
.dot2 {
	background-image: url(../images/dot2.jpg);
	background-repeat: repeat-x;
	background-position: center bottom;
}
.red_dot {
	font-family: "黑体";
	font-size: 20px;
	color: #FFFFFF;
	text-decoration: none;
	background-image: url(../images/red_dot.jpg);
	background-repeat: no-repeat;
	background-position: center center;
}
.font1 {
	font-family: "宋体";
	font-size: 12px;
	line-height: 18px;
	color: #4F4F4F;
	text-decoration: none;
}
.font2 {
	font-size: 12px;
	color: #B5B3B4;
}
.font3 {
	font-size: 12px;
	font-weight: bold;
	color: #DB0D0F;
	text-decoration: none;
}
.font4 {
	font-size: 14px;
	font-weight:bold;
	color: #5B6870;
	text-decoration: none;
	line-height: 150%;
}
.font5 {
	font-size: 12px;
	color: #DB0D0F;
}
.f-gray {
	line-height: 150%;
	color: #666666;
	padding-left: 45px;
}
.f-gray2 {
	line-height: 140%;
	color: #5B6870;
	font-weight: bold;
	background: #FFFFFF;
}
.f-gray3 {
	line-height: 140%;
	color: #5B6870;
	text-decoration: none;
}


.f-white {
	color: #FFFFFF;
	text-decoration: none;
}




.manufacture_bg {
	background-image: url(../images/menu_bg.jpg);
	background-repeat: repeat-x;
	background-position: center top;
}
.manufacture_bg2 {
	background-image: url(../images/manufacture_bg.jpg);
	background-repeat: no-repeat;
	background-position: center center;
}
.manufacture_3 {
	background-image: url(../images/manufacture_bg2.jpg);
	background-repeat: no-repeat;
	background-position: center top;
}
.searchbox {
	height: 13px;
}
.btn_red {
	color: #FFFFFF;
	background: #CC0000;
	border-style: none;
	font-size: 12px;
}





.menu_360_bg {
	background-image: url(../images/menu_360_bg.jpg);
	background-repeat: repeat-x;
	background-position: center top;
}

.service_pic {
	background-image: url(../images/service_pic.jpg);
	background-repeat: no-repeat;
	background-position: right top;
}
.service_pic2 {
	background-image: url(../images/pic2.jpg);
	background-repeat: no-repeat;
	background-position: right bottom;
}
.ash_2 {
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#E9EAEC;
}

.ash3 {
	border: 4px solid E5E5E5;
}
.ash4 {
	border-right-width: 1px;
	border-right-style: solid;
	border-right-color: #E4E4E4;
}

.ash_biankuang {
	height: 18px;
	border: 1px solid D6D6D6;
	background-color: #F6F6F6;
}
.blueness_table {
	border-top: 1px solid #99AABC;
	border-left: 1px solid #99AABC;
}
.blueness_table2 {
	border-right: 1px solid #99AABC;
	border-bottom: 1px solid #99AABC;
}

